The present invention relates to a digital RF repeater, which receives a base station signal from a donor ANT, which performs low-noise amplification of the received RF signal by using an LNA, and which converts the RF signal into an intermediate frequency (IF) in an RF down converter. The RF down converter performs frequency conversion by using a local signal generated in an RF IC, converts the IF signal into a digital signal by using an AD converter, performs DSP processing in an FPGA, performs RF conversion of a DSP-processed digital I/Q signal by using the RF IC, amplifies the signal in a power AMP, and outputs the amplified signal to a service ANT via a duplex filter.
